Merge pull request #8890 from owncloud/cleanup-trashsizes-table-master

table files_trashsizes was still used in some locations -> removed
remotes/origin/ldap_group_count
Thomas Müller 11 years ago
commit f955209a5a
  1. 26
      apps/files_trashbin/appinfo/database.xml
  2. 9
      apps/files_trashbin/lib/trashbin.php

@ -89,30 +89,4 @@
</table>
<table>
<name>*dbprefix*files_trashsize</name>
<declaration>
<field>
<name>user</name>
<type>text</type>
<default></default>
<notnull>true</notnull>
<length>64</length>
</field>
<field>
<name>size</name>
<type>text</type>
<default></default>
<notnull>true</notnull>
<length>50</length>
</field>
</declaration>
</table>
</database>

@ -655,17 +655,12 @@ class Trashbin {
/**
* deletes used space for trash bin in db if user was deleted
*
* @param type $uid id of deleted user
* @param string $uid id of deleted user
* @return bool result of db delete operation
*/
public static function deleteUser($uid) {
$query = \OC_DB::prepare('DELETE FROM `*PREFIX*files_trash` WHERE `user`=?');
$result = $query->execute(array($uid));
if ($result) {
$query = \OC_DB::prepare('DELETE FROM `*PREFIX*files_trashsize` WHERE `user`=?');
return $query->execute(array($uid));
}
return false;
return $query->execute(array($uid));
}
/**

Loading…
Cancel
Save